Pixel Craft Mumbi Magic has taken India's mobile gaming scene by storm since its 2022 release. Developed by Mumbai-based DreamPixel Studios, this charming crafting adventure game blends vibrant pixel art with Indian cultural elements, creating a uniquely Indian gaming experience.
With over 5 million downloads across India and an impressive 4.7/5 average rating on the Google Play Store, Pixel Craft Mumbi Magic has become a cultural phenomenon. The game's success stems from its perfect balance of accessible gameplay, deep crafting systems, and celebration of Indian heritage.

Pixel Craft Mumbi Magic combines elements of crafting, exploration, and adventure in a magical Indian setting. The game world of Mumbi is divided into distinct regions, each inspired by different parts of India:
The crafting system deserves special mention. Players gather resources like "Himalayan Herbs," "Deccan Ores," and "Coastal Pearls" to craft everything from weapons to decorative items. The most popular crafted item? The "Tricolor Banner," created during Independence Day events.

The Indian version of Pixel Craft Mumbi Magic differs significantly from its global counterpart:
| Feature | Indian Version | Global Version |
|---|---|---|
| Languages | 5 Indian languages | English only |
| Currencies | ₹ (Rupee) pricing | $ (Dollar) pricing |
| Events | Indian festivals | Global holidays |
| Content | Indian-themed items | Generic fantasy items |
| Servers | Indian data centers | Global servers |
